Re: Capacity Planning - Calculating Memory Usage
Hi Val, I'm sorry, of course only @QuerySqlField(index = true) makes an index on objects field. Fields without indexes make none additional overhead. Group index on multiple fields is a one index (isn't it?) I don't understand what is still unclear. Entry footprint = key footprint + value footprint + entry overhead + index overhead. Re: Capacity Planning - Calculating Memory Usage
Hi Val, the understanding is simple. When you enables the single index on entry class you get "First index overhead" per entry. When you enables two indices on entry class you get "First index overhead" + "Next index overhead" per entry. With three indices you get "First index overhead" + 2 * "Next index overhead", and so on... Each annotated field with @QuerySqlField is an index, except multiple fields annotated with @QuerySqlField.Group. Another way to defining indices is to use property "queryEntities" and it's subproperty "indexes". Re: Capacity Planning - Calculating Memory Usage
Alexandr, In addition. If expire policy is configured, there is additional overhead to entries can be tracked by TtlManager. This overhead is OnHeap and does not depend on cache MemoryMode (until Ignite-3840 will be in master). For now overhead is about 32-40 bytes (EntryWrapper itself) + (40-48) bytes (ConcurrentSkipList node) per entry.
